Where is Beverley Hull Bridge Road?

Where is Beverley Hull Bridge Road located?

Beverley Hull Bridge Road, Beverley Hull Bridge Road, Great Britain (approx. 53.85323°, -0.4187°)


Where is Beverley Hull Bridge Road on the map?